## Notice

The Drive Project is a response to domestic abuse that aims to reduce the number of child and adult victims of domestic abuse by disrupting and changing perpetrator behaviour. It implements a whole-system approach through an intensive individual case management intervention alongside a co-ordinated multi-agency response to drive perpetrators to change their behaviour. The Drive Project focuses on increasing victim safety alongside the crucial protective work of victims' services. The service has been developed to knit together existing services, complementing and enhancing existing interventions. Conducted under Section 7 of Chapter 3 of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 It is intended that the Contract will be awarded in March 2023 with mobilisation commencing 1st April 2023 for a Go-Live date of 1 August 2023. The Contract shall be awarded (subject to Funding) for an initial period of 2 years with the possibility for the contract to be extended for a period of up to a maximum of 2 additional years from and including the Contract start date but will be subject to the terms set out in the Contract.
